Разработка программного комплекса по распознаванию маркеров

2 000 руб.за час • наличный расчёт, безналичный расчёт
15 марта 2018, 17:52 • 2 отклика • 68 просмотров

Техническое задание для разработки программного комплекса по распознаванию маркеров совместно с ARkit

Требования - Unity3d, С#
Опционально знание OpenCV
Необходимо разработать или найти существующее решение которое позволит определять, с помощью сканирования маркера, направление устройства относительно реального мира, в градусах компаса. Решение должно быть реализовано при помощи unity3d 2017.3 или выше.
Технические требования :
1) Реализация- Unity 2017.3 и выше, актуальная версия ARkit
2) Решение должно работать параллельно с ARkit и не иметь задержки при распознавании изображений
3) При распознавании маркера необходимо определять координаты маркера в пространcтве unity3d чтобы иметь возожность выполнить наложение графики поверх маркера
4) Погрешность угла при распознавании не должна превышать 5 градусов при относительном наклоне макркера к устройству до 45 градусов с любого ракурса
5) Решение должно стабильно работать при текущих требованиях на устройстве IPadPro(2017) 10.5 дюймов.
6) Маркер должен представлять собой черно-белую матрицу размером 5x5 или более подходящую для решения визуальную альтернативу.

Примерная реализация https://www.youtube.com/watch?v=w7nAsGYuFnI (ARkit 1.5 распознавание изображений не подходит, слишком большая погрешность )

Рекомендации по выполнению : Ближайшее возможное решение ARkit и OpenCV , так как они не мешают работе друг друга